Receptionist & Office Assistant

Operations · Full-time · England, United Kingdom

Job description

Reports to: EA to CEO

  

Job Purpose: This role oversees and maintains ITC’s Front of House, as well as supporting and assisting in all aspects of office and facilities management – ensuring the highest possible quality of service at the best cost. This role is the public face of ITC to staff and visitors and is responsible for creating a safe, clean and welcoming environment.

 Key Interfaces: ITC Employees, Visitors, Landlord and associated Agent, Building Facilities Provider, Third Party Suppliers

The Role will Involve:

  • General reception duties, including answering and forwarding all calls on the switchboard, meeting room allocation, greeting and offering refreshments to guests, management of incoming and outgoing post and courier services;
  • Ensuring Reception and meeting rooms are kept presentable for visitors at all times, including responsibility for the kitchen area, dishwashers and coffee machine;
  • Catering and vending for office provisions and meetings;
  • General upkeep of the office; office supplies replenishment, cleaning company liaison, plants, waste disposal and recycling, milkman, updating the internal phone list, arranging necessary repairs and liaising with 3rd parties for maintenance of all office equipment including photocopier, printers and franking machine;
  • Checking that agreed work by staff or contractors has been completed satisfactorily and following up on any deficiencies
  • Suggesting changes to working practices as needed
  • Arranging upkeep including signage, lighting, safety and electrical testing where necessary;
  • Keeping records of inspection findings, incidents and accidents;
  • Monitoring visitor access and maintaining security awareness, ensuring that all guests are correctly signed in and out and are wearing visible visitors passes at all times;
  • Managing the physical security of the office including acting as the Relationship manager with the building management, security, and reception teams;
  • Acting as the key contact with the landlord on building maintenance and associated areas e.g. lifts and air-conditioning;
  • Providing general administrative and clerical support to internal departments as and when necessary
  • Maintaining the front of house process guide
  • Undertaking other duties from time to time as required
